Every one of those logs seems to have a 'Sense Key: 0x05 (KEY_ILLEGAL_REQUEST)' error. And using 'MCC, Media Type ID: 004' is very questionable, usually ranging from bad to poor in quality.
The first error usually relates to a communication problem between the system and your burner. If your burner is IDE, replace the data cable. If that fails, maybe the burner itself is dying.
But the first thing I would try is better media. One sign of cheap media is inconsistancy with the media quality. And if you are downloading crap quality movies from the internet, that may also be your problem. -

It's sort of a generic Nero error. Usually it means that Nero was looking for a particular memory location and couldn't find it. It could be because of bad media, a failing burner, a bad data cable, a bad hard drive or something running in the background on the computer, stealing CPU cycles. This page of Nero errors is from our friends at Digital Digest: http://forum.digital-digest.com/showthread.php?t=45942
Easiest is to substitute known good DVD media and see if that helps, then check for processes running on the computer that my be interrupting the data flow. Then change out the data cable, then change out or substitute the burner. I would also try ImgBurn and see if it's error log gives any better information.
MMC 004 is the manufacturer of the media, no matter what brand is on the label. If you go to our 'DVD Media' page to the left, you would get this by inputting MCC 004 into the 'Search Media Code box: https://www.videohelp.com/dvdmedia?dvdmediasearch=&dvdmediadvdridsearch=MCC.....004+&ty...+or+List+Media It generally lists as 'good', but there is a lot of variation. Some known good brands of DVD media are Verbatim and Taiyo Yuden, though the latter is almost always only available from mail order sources.
